Historical & Cultural Background
The name Kalyia is believed to have roots in the Sanskrit language, where it is derived from the word "kali," which means "black" or "dark." This term is often associated with the Hindu goddess Kali, a powerful figure representing destruction and transformation, who embodies the duality of creation and destruction. The name may also be linked to the broader cultural significance of darkness in various traditions, symbolizing mystery, depth, and the unknown.
The transition of the name into English likely occurred through the influence of Indian culture and spirituality, particularly during the colonial period when interest in Eastern philosophies grew in the West. Historically, the goddess Kali has been worshipped since ancient times, with references to her found in texts such as the "Devi Mahatmya," a scripture dating back to the 5th century CE, which highlights her importance in the Shakta tradition of Hinduism.
The name Kalyia, while not as widely recognized as Kali, may carry similar connotations of strength and resilience, reflecting the qualities attributed to the goddess. Over the centuries, the name has likely been adopted and adapted in various forms across cultures, particularly among those influenced by Hindu traditions.

U.S. Historical Usage
The name Kalyia was first seen in the United States in 2003.
Kalyia has ranked as high as #24776 nationally, which occurred in 2003, and has been most popular in .
In the past 5 years the name Kalyia has been trending up compared to the previous 5 years.
